The first edition of The GitHub Reflog, curated by Kenneth Reitz, highlights notable GitHub repositories, featuring devstructure/blueprint as the Repo of the Week for its ability to reverse engineer servers and create replicable server setups through bootstrap packages. The newsletter also showcases drbrain/meme, a Ruby gem for generating meme images from the command line, and taitems/Aristo-jQuery-UI-Theme, which offers a visually appealing theme for jQuery UI. Other noteworthy projects include brainsik/virtualenv-burrito, which simplifies Python environment setup, maccman/ichabod for running headless JavaScript tests, and twitter/commons, a collection of Twitter's internal JVM libraries. Additionally, extend/cowboy is highlighted as an evolving Erlang HTTP server project, with Kenneth inviting feedback and contributions while promoting The Changelog and GitHub Explore for further open source news.
